Obituary from the Register-Herald, Eaton, OH:
Wesley E. Hinkle
Died: Tuesday, December 25, 2001

Wesley E. Hinkle, 82, of West Alexandria, died Tuesday, Dec. 25, at his home.
Born Oct. 5, 1919, in Clark, Ohio, he was the son of Wilbur and Ethel (Croutwater) Hinkle. Mr. Hinkle was a farmer most of his life, and a member of Lower Twin Old German Baptist Brethren Church.
Survivors include his wife of 45 years, Agnes (Brubaker) Hinkle; one brother, Bruce Hinkle of Urbana; two sisters, Alice Parker of Springfield and Anna Johnson of Ludlow, Ky.; nieces and nephews.
Funeral services were Friday, Dec. 28, at the Upper Twin Old German Baptist Brethren Church, West Alexandria, with The Brethren officiating. Burial was in Sugar Grove Cemetery, West Alexandria. Lindloff-Zimmerman Funeral Home, West Alexandria, was in charge of arrangements.
